Does anyone have access to the Leverington marriage register please and could possibly check a marriage which appears on an ancestry tree?

Robert Tansley and Sarah Bell
11 April 1774

The tree lists witnesses but no other details and I'm wondering if it says anything about marital status or place of abode, although I appreciate it may say neither.

I'm looking for a marriage of a Robert and Sarah Tansley who had children in neighbouring Newton in the Isle from 1775 and this seems a likely marriage because there doesn't appear to be any children to them in Leverington.  However, the aforementioned tree states that Sarah was born 1747 in Leverington, but the burial in Newton in the Isle for Sarah Tansley lists her as born in 1752.

The only extra details for the marriage in the register are that Robert was a bac and Sarah a sp plus they were both otp and both made their marks.

There is a baptism at Leverington on 26 May 1747 of a Sarah Bell daughter of Thomas and Sarah.
On 12 August 1744 a Valentine Bell was baptised also son of Thomas and Sarah and he was one of the witnesses at the marriage in 1774.

There is also a baptism in Newton in the Isle of a Sarah Bell to a Thomas and Sarah in 1752 and I think, from memory, a Valentine Bell appears in there too later on.  I wonder if Thomas and Sarah Bell were parish hopping, but I suppose it'll depend on whether there is a burial for the first Sarah in Leverington or Newton before 1752, haven't checked the latter yet.  The burial for Sarah Tansley does suggest a 1752 birth not 1747. :-\

On the Cambs FHS site supersearch http://www.cfhs.org.uk/ there is a Sarah Bell listed for 1751 and looking at the Cambs Burial Index this is a burial of Sarah at Newton in the Isle in 1751.

Unfortunately the index doesn't give any more details, sometimes an age is noted, so whether this was a child or adult I don't know.
